Title :
Amplitude controlled reflectarray using non-uniform FSS reflection plane

Abstract :
A novel concept using non-uniform frequency selective surface (FSS) backed as a reflection plane for amplitude controlled reflectarray is proposed. First, a modified square-loop FSS element with broad reflection response band (from -22dB to 0dB) is designed. Then, a non-uniform FSS using the modified square-loop element is backed as a reflection plane for reflectarray. By properly controlling each element size of the FSS, the reflection amplitude from the reflectarray element can be sufficiently controlled and amplitude controlled reflectarray can be realized. A reflectarray using Dolph-Tschebyscheff weighting coefficients is implemented and a major-lobe to sidelobe ratios of up to 22 dB is obtained.
